Output ed84b6ac1a59d5104b3286c41fc651d2bd2241c22ec211ab70c61e19e6629c12:1

value
448292295
script pubkey
OP_0 OP_PUSHBYTES_20 89f26b982b666216e2a0a8cdd2257fed64571f0f
address
bc1q38exhxptve3pdc4q4rxayftla4j9w8c002cmfl
transaction
ed84b6ac1a59d5104b3286c41fc651d2bd2241c22ec211ab70c61e19e6629c12
confirmations
88406
spent
true